In a major development related to the electric vehicle infrastructure of India, Servotech Power Systems Ltd. has bagged a significant order for nearly 1500 DC fast EV chargers from state-run Hindustan Petroleum Corporation Limited (HPCL) and other EV charger OEMs.

According to an exchange filing, the order is worth Rs 102 crores and involves two charger variants of 60 kW and 120 kW.

Servotech said that the order will involve manufacturing, supplying and installing DC EV chargers nationwide with priority being on deployment at HPCL's retail outlets. Additionally, Servotech will also manufacture and supply the rest of the chargers to EV charger OEMs. 

This move aims to promote EVs in India by building a consumer-friendly and well-connected EV charging infrastructure. It will also promote decarbonized mobility and cater to the evolving needs of the sustainable automotive industry.
